AI-Generated Summary

The Warchant Podcasts' Seminole Headlines Hour 2 dives deep into Florida State athletics with candid, unfiltered takes on the football and baseball programs in 2026. The hosts debate whether head football coach Mike Norvell would survive a 7-5 season, acknowledging the precedent set by his retention after a 3-7 record, but arguing that a 5-5 record two years after a 1-10 season would be unsustainable due to recruiting collapse and lack of tangible progress. They stress that the program’s current roster lacks depth, especially at quarterback and infield defense, and that the coaching staff’s inability to build a championship-caliber team despite talent is a systemic failure. On the baseball front, the hosts express frustration over the team’s defensive shortcomings and lineup instability, particularly after the loss of star hitter Miles Bailey, calling the current roster a 'tinkering' project rather than a contender. They argue that while the team could still win a Super Regional, it’s no longer a 'stunning' outcome — a sign of declining standards. The episode ends with a rallying cry: Florida State must rebuild its identity, not just its record, to reclaim its place among national powers.
